Merge two rows based on multiple column values
Hi all
The simplified version of the table looks like this:
And from that, I need something like the picture below, IF two rows' ID, Field and Type fields are the same, they should be merged while creating 2 new columns. (ones without a match, should be discarded)
Hello skutovicsakos ,
check out this solution. It works with grouping and pivoting and its not dynamic. If only one row its found its deleted, with 2 rows works fine, if 3 rows are found they are deleted as well, because the program is not able to handle it.
let Quelle = Table.FromRows(Json.Document(Binary.Decompress(Binary.FromText("i45WMlTSUUoE4YKCnFQg7QHEboZGxkqxOhDJJFySRlCdSYl5QAhk+AMxikx+UWJeeipUxtBU18QcLp2ErhEqHQsA", BinaryEncoding.Base64), Compression.Deflate)), let _t = ((type text) meta [Serialized.Text = true]) in type table [ID = _t, Point = _t, Field = _t, Type = _t, Value = _t]), #"Geänderter Typ" = Table.TransformColumnTypes(Quelle,{{"ID", Int64.Type}, {"Point", type text}, {"Field", type text}, {"Type", type text}, {"Value", type text}}), PivotTable = (tTable as table) => let DeleteNotNeededColumns = Table.SelectColumns ( tTable, {"Point", "Value"} ), AddIndex = Table.AddIndexColumn ( DeleteNotNeededColumns, "Index", 1, 1 ), CreateRecordColumn = Table.AddColumn ( AddIndex, "Complete Row", each _ ), KeepIndexAndCompleteColumn = Table.SelectColumns ( CreateRecordColumn, {"Index", "Complete Row"} ), PivotColumn = Table.Pivot ( Table.TransformColumnTypes ( KeepIndexAndCompleteColumn, {{"Index", type text}}, "de-DE" ), List.Distinct ( Table.TransformColumnTypes ( KeepIndexAndCompleteColumn, {{"Index", type text}}, "de-DE" )[Index] ), "Index", "Complete Row" ), ExpandFirstColumn = Table.ExpandRecordColumn ( PivotColumn, "1", {"Point", "Value"}, {"1.Point", "1.Value"} ), ExpandSecondColumn = Table.ExpandRecordColumn ( ExpandFirstColumn, "2", {"Point", "Value"}, {"2.Point", "2.Value"} ) in ExpandSecondColumn, GroupTable = Table.Group ( #"Geänderter Typ" , {"ID", "Field", "Type"}, { {"AllRows", each _, type table [ID=number, Point=text, Field=text, Type=text, Value=text]}, {"RowCount", each Table.RowCount(_), type number} } ), FilterTable = Table.SelectRows ( GroupTable, each ([RowCount] = 2) ), ApplyCustomFunction = Table.AddColumn ( FilterTable, "NewColumn", each PivotTable([AllRows]) ), DeleteColumns = Table.RemoveColumns(ApplyCustomFunction,{"AllRows", "RowCount"}), ExpandColumns = Table.ExpandTableColumn(DeleteColumns, "NewColumn", {"1.Point", "1.Value", "2.Point", "2.Value"}, {"1.Point", "1.Value", "2.Point", "2.Value"}) in ExpandColumnsIf this post helps or solves your problem, please mark it as solution.

The solution below will not require a custom function.
let Quelle = Table.FromRows(Json.Document(Binary.Decompress(Binary.FromText("i45WMlTSUUoE4YKCnFQg7QHEboZGxkqxOhDJJFySRlCdSYl5QAhk+AMxikx+UWJeeipUxtBU18QcLp2ErhEqHQsA", BinaryEncoding.Base64), Compression.Deflate)), let _t = ((type text) meta [Serialized.Text = true]) in type table [ID = _t, Point = _t, Field = _t, Type = _t, Value = _t]), #"Geänderter Typ" = Table.TransformColumnTypes(Quelle,{{"ID", Int64.Type}, {"Point", type text}, {"Field", type text}, {"Type", type text}, {"Value", type text}}), #"Grouped Rows" = Table.Group(#"Geänderter Typ", {"ID", "Field", "Type"}, { {"Point", each List.First([Point]), type text}, {"Value", each List.First([Value]), type text}, {"AllData", each _, type table [ID=number, Point=text, Field=text, Type=text, Value=text]}}), #"Filtered Rows" = Table.SelectRows(#"Grouped Rows", each Table.RowCount([AllData])=2 ), Transform = Table.TransformColumns(#"Filtered Rows",{{"AllData", each _{1}, type record}}), #"Expanded AllData" = Table.ExpandRecordColumn(Transform, "AllData", {"Point", "Value"}, {"D_Point", "D_Value"}), #"Reordered Columns" = Table.ReorderColumns(#"Expanded AllData",{"ID", "Point", "Field", "Type", "Value", "D_Point", "D_Value"}) in #"Reordered Columns"
